Summary

Three new contenders have entered the Presidential race on the Republican side this week, how does the growing field impact frontrunner, former President Donald Trump? FOX News Contributor and Host of FOX News Radio's The Guy Benson Show, Guy Benson shares why he believes the Republican nomination is a two-man race between former President Trump and Florida Governor DeSantis.    Later, Guy weighs in on how a potential indictment of former President Trump for obstruction of justice and the mishandling of classified documents could factor into the race.  Learn more about your ad choices.
